University of Nevada, Las Vegas BSN




 

Basic Information: University of Nevada, Las Vegas is located in Las Vegas, Nevada.  This program is set up for the entry-level freshman wishing to gain their BSN or transfer students who have completed their general education requirements.

Must Dos: Apply to University of Nevada Las Vegas first.  Talk with a pre-nursing counselor about the most efficient way to get your prerequisite classes done and how to apply for the nursing program.  

Program Length: After completion of prerequisite classes, students take classes for four consecutive semesters.  Each semester is 15 weeks long.  The BSN program takes a total of 16 months to complete once students are admitted to the program.  The "Plan of Study" or classes you take at UNLV can be found here

Prerequisites: In addition to general education credits, students must take Fundamentals of Life Science, Anatomy & Physiology I/II (minimum grade B), Microbiology (minimum grade B), Introduction to Chemistry, Statistics, and Nutrition (minimum grade B).   A list of all the prerequisite and general education classes required can be found here

Prior Classwork Information: Students must have a cumulative GPA of at least a 3.0 or better.

Application Information: The application to University of Nevada Las Vegas can be found here.  Application deadlines for the College of Nursing are the last business day in February for Summer Semester, the last business day of June for Winter Semester, and last business day in October for Spring Semester.

Admission Tests: Students must take the HESI A2 Exam.  You have two chances to get a passing score of 75% or higher. If you are a non-native English speaker, you must provide your test score for the Test of English as a Foreign Language (TOEFL).
